摘要
The L shell x-ray intensity ratios L alpha/Ll, L alpha/L beta, and L alpha/L gamma for Ta, W, Au, Hg, T1, Pb, Bi, Th, and U have been measured using the 59.54keV incident photon energy in the external magnetic field of intensities +/- 0.15, +/- 0.45, and +/- 0.75T. A comparison is made of the experimental values obtained for B = 0 with calculated values using theoretical x-ray emission rates, subshell ionization cross sections, subshell fluorescence yields and Coster-Kronig transitions probabilities. In the absence of external magnetic field, a fairly agreement is observed between experimental and theoretical values.
